Structure and Working Principle
The flat elevator cable typically consists of multiple copper conductors insulated with PVC or rubber materials. These conductors are arranged in a flat configuration to minimize space usage while maintaining flexibility. The cable often includes reinforced shielding to protect against electromagnetic interference and mechanical damage. During operation, the cable moves with the elevator car, bending and flexing as the car ascends and descends. The design ensures minimal wear and tear, even with frequent use, making it a long-lasting solution for vertical transportation systems.

Maintenance and Precautions
Proper maintenance of flat elevator cable is essential to ensure its longevity and performance. Regular inspections should be conducted to check for signs of wear, such as fraying or cracks in the insulation. Any damaged sections should be replaced promptly to prevent failures. During installation, avoid excessive bending or twisting, as this can weaken the cable over time. Ensure that the cable is routed correctly and secured to minimize movement and friction. Following these precautions will help maintain the cable's integrity and reliability.
